Opt for a Room with a View
Several guests mentioned the spectacular views from the rooms, especially those facing the rooftops and city, providing a special experience.
Consider Noise Levels
Some guests experienced noise disturbances during the night, particularly on weekends, due to the hotel's location in an old building. Light sleepers may want to prepare for this.
Take Advantage of the Location
The hotel's central location in the historic area of Maastricht offers easy access to shops, restaurants, and main attractions, making it convenient for exploring the city.
Be Mindful of Stairs
The hotel does not have an elevator, and some rooms are located on higher floors. Guests with mobility concerns or heavy luggage may want to consider this before booking.
Check for Alternative Breakfast Options
While the hotel no longer offers sit-down breakfast, guests can pick up take-away items from the reception. Those expecting a traditional breakfast experience may want to plan accordingly.
Consider Room Amenities
The rooms are spacious and clean, but guests should note that food and drink options are not available within the hotel. However, the central location makes it easy to access dining options nearby.
Note the Quirks of a Historic Building
As the hotel is situated in a historic building, guests should expect some quirks such as creaky floors and steep, narrow stairs. This adds to the charm but may not be suitable for all guests.
Parking Considerations
The hotel offers secured parking, but it is located a 10-minute walk away. Guests arriving by car should plan for this and consider unloading luggage in the nearby area.
Enjoy the Family-Run Atmosphere
Guests appreciated the welcoming and attentive nature of the reception staff and cleaning personnel, creating a family-run small hotel feeling.
Be Aware of Noise and Ventilation
Some guests noted issues with noise from the street, as well as the lack of ventilation in the bathroom. Light sleepers and those sensitive to air quality may want to take this into account.

Galerie Hotel Dis is located at Tafelstraat 28 in Jekerkwartier, 0,3 km from the centre of Maastricht. Natural History Museum is the closest landmark to Galerie Hotel Dis.
Check-in time is 14:00 and check-out time is 11:00 at Galerie Hotel Dis.
Yes, Galerie Hotel Dis offers free Wi-Fi.
Galerie Hotel Dis is 9,1 km from Maastricht/Aachen. Galerie Hotel Dis is 29 km from Liège Bierset.
